Azerbaijan, Baku, August 2 / Trend /
The State Oil Company of Azerbaijan Republic (SOCAR) exported more than 1.52 million tons of oil from January to July 2013 from the port of Supsa compared to nearly 1.61 million tons of oil in the same period of 2012, a statement released by SOCAR on Friday said.
According to the report, some 157.7 thousand tons of oil were exported from Supsa in July, compared to 315.32 thousand tons in the same period of the last year.
SOCAR exported 2.74 million tons of oil from Supsa in 2012, compared to 2.65 million tons of oil in 2011. The oil is delivered to Supsa through the Baku-Supsa oil pipeline. The operator of Baku-Supsa pipeline is the Azerbaijan International Operational Company (AIOC).
